随笔分类 - [15]Dev Tools
-
SublimeText编辑器替代notepad++了
摘要:可以考虑使用SublimeText编辑器替代notepad++了内容目录:插件安装配置配置打包下载大概是去年吧,这款编辑器神一般的出现在我面前,经过我小心翼翼的试用后发现并不是那么太顺手,插件配置都不太成熟,如Package Control。 最喜欢用它的zencoding还得专门开个小窗@,随后放弃。今年升级过MAC系统后始终找不到一款合适的家常编辑器,MAC上好用的多数又收费, 而且不想在MAC上和WIN上用两款不同的编辑器,之前用的notepad++在MAC上又没有,后来想起了它,SublimeText,传送门:http://www.sublimetext.com/3!SublimeTe 阅读全文
-
Emacs颜色设置
摘要:Emacs颜色设置写下自己Emacs的颜色设置的过程,以防自己忘了,借此也和大家分享一下。 版本:Emacs 23.3.1 emacs安装目录:/usr/share/emacs 谷歌了一番之后发现,对我们新手而言,一般是用别人已经写好的themes(如果你对Elisp有一定的了解,而且愿意花时间的话,当然也可以自己定制自己喜欢的颜色罗^-^) 装完后回过头来看,大概的安装步骤是这样的: 下载color-theme安装包→ color-theme解压后将其中的color-theme.el文件和themes文件夹移动到你的插件目录→ 修改配置文件(~/.emacs)→ M-x color-... 阅读全文
-
Vi编辑器入门
摘要:Vi编辑器入门vi编辑器是所有Unix及Linux系统下标准的编辑器,类似于windows上的记事本! 1、vi的基本概念 基本上vi可以分为三种状态,分别是命令模式(command mode)、插入模式(Insert mode)和底行模式(last line mode),各模式的功能区分如下:1) 命令行模式command mode) 控制屏幕光标的移动,字符、字或行的删除,移动复制某区段及进入Insert mode下,或者到 last line mode。2) 插入模式(Insert mode) 只有在Insert mode下,才可以做文字输入,按「ESC」键可回到命令行模式。3) ... 阅读全文
-
baidu 200兆SVN代码服务器
摘要:转今天心情好,给各位免费呈上200兆SVN代码服务器一枚,不谢! 开篇先给大家讲个我自己的故事,几个月前在网上接了个小软件开发的私活,平日上班时间也比较忙,就中午一会儿休息时间能抽出来倒腾着去做点。每天下班复制一份到U盘带回去继续摸索,没多久U盘里躺着的文件列表那叫一个雷人,大概跟大学毕业前的论文整改一样(如下图)每天这样复制来复制去还可以忍受,过了几天,软件还没开发结束,客户的思维随着时间的推移对已做的功能要进行部分增减,噢,my god ,我去年买了个登山包,超耐磨!!!我需要从历史的版本去参考一些代码,看着这么多的最终版,该从哪里找啊 ???故事就讲到这,最后软件虽然如期交工了,但这.. 阅读全文
-
CentOS+nginx+uwsgi+Python 多站点环境搭建
摘要:CentOS+nginx+uwsgi+Python 多站点环境搭建环境:CentOS X64 6.4nginx 1.5.6Python 2.7.5正文:一:安装需要的类库及Python2.7.5安装必要的开发包yum groupinstall "Development tools"yum install zlib-devel bzip2-devel pcre-devel openssl-devel ncurses-devel sqlite-devel readline-devel tk-develCentOS 自带Python2.6.6,但我们可以再安装Python2.7. 阅读全文
-
Vim
摘要:转至:实用手册:130+ 提高开发效率的 vim 常用命令 Vim 是从 vi 发展出来的一个文本编辑器。代码补完、编译及错误跳转等方便编程的功能特别丰富,在程序员中被广泛使用。和 Emacs 并列成为类 Unix 系统用户最喜欢的编辑器。这里收录了130+程序员必备的 vim 命令,帮助你提高开发效率。您可能感兴趣的相关文章12个优秀资源让你迅速精通正则表达式10大流行的 Metro 风格 Bootstrap 主题分享35个立体动感的视差滚动效果网站作品让人爱不释手的13套 Web 应用程序图标推荐10套精美的免费网站后台管理系统模板基本命令:e filenameOpenfilenamefo 阅读全文
-
NetCat,在网络工具中有“瑞士军刀”美誉
摘要:nc命令详解NetCat,在网络工具中有“瑞士军刀”美誉,其有Windows和Linux的版本。因为它短小精悍(1.84版本也不过25k,旧版本或缩减版甚至更小)、功能实用,被设计为一个简单、可靠的网络工具,可通过TCP或UDP协议传输读写数据。同时,它还是一个网络应用Debug分析器,因为它可以根据需要创建各种不同类型的网络连接。通常的Linux发行版中都带有NetCat(简称nc),但不同的版本,其参数的使用略有差异。NetCat 官方地址:http://netcat.sourceforge.net/安装[root@server ~]# yum install -y nc[root@ser 阅读全文
-
[转]SVN操作手册
摘要:[转]SVN操作手册2012-04-28 11:26 by NewSea,2495阅读,0评论,收藏,编辑原文:http://hi.baidu.com/caiqiupeng/blog/item/2ce2e9df55284e1a622798fa.html1.为什么要用VisualSVN Server,而不用Subversion?回答:因为如果直接使用Subversion,那么在Windows 系统上,要想让它随系统启动,就要封装SVN Server为windws service,还要通过修改配置文件来控制用户权限,另外如果要想以Web方式【http协议】访问,一般还要安装配置Apache,如果是 阅读全文
-
vim复制
摘要:关于vim复制剪贴粘贴命令的总结最近在使用vim,感觉很好很强大,但是在使用复制剪切粘贴命令是,碰到了一些小困惑,网上找了一些资料感觉很不全,讲的也不好,遂自己进行实践并总结了。首先是剪切(删除):剪切其实也就顺带删除了所选择的内容,所以既可以当剪切命令用,也可以当删除命令使用。 1 首先,可以在命令模式下输入v进入自由选取模式,选择需要剪切的文字后,按下d就可以进行剪切了。 2 其他命令模式下剪切命令: 3 dd:剪切当前行 4 ndd:n表示大于1的数字,剪切n行 5 dw:从光标处剪切至一个单子/单词的末尾,包括空格 6 de:从光标处剪切至一个单子/单词的末尾,不包括空格 7 d$:从 阅读全文
-
如何利用花生壳和VisualSVN Server建立远程代码仓库
摘要:如何利用花生壳和VisualSVN Server建立远程代码仓库 如何利用花生壳和VisualSVN建立远程代码仓库 最近由于项目需要,要远程访问实验室的svn服务器,但是实验室没有固定域名和ip,因此就打算用花生壳申请一个免费的域名构建一个服务器,再把VisualSVN部署在服务器上,就可以在外网访问了(如果你有固定的域名和服务器就不用这么麻烦了)。下面说一下具体创建过程;一.安装VisualSVN Server VisualSVN Server下载地址:http://www.visualsvn.com/server/ VisualSVN Server的具体安装和配置... 阅读全文
-
MSSQL数据库迁移到Oracle
摘要:MSSQL数据库迁移到Oracle最近要把一个MSSQL数据库迁移到Oracle上面,打算借助PowerDesigner这个软件来实现;今天简单研究一下这个软件的运用;把一步简单的操作步骤记录下来;第一步:建立相应的链接1:首先我们打开PowerDesigner,并新建一个Physical Data Model2:工具栏里的"数据库"-->Configure Connections3:点击新建一个数据库连接4:选择系统数据源,然后下一步5:因为我们这个源数据是MSSQL2005,所以接下来我们选择驱动程序为SQL Server6:然后下一步7:填写数据源的名称还有相应 阅读全文
-
Hello Vagrant
摘要:Hello Vagrant回想以前,想要安装个虚拟机是多么的麻烦。先要费尽心机找到想要的操作系统镜像文件,然后安装虚拟化软件,按照其提供的GUI界面操作一步步创建,整个过程费时费力。但是,自从使用了Vagrant以后,咱腰不酸了,腿不痛了,一口气起5个虚拟机还不费劲。Vagrant是什么?这是官网上Vagrant的介绍。Create and Configure lightweight, reproducible, and portable development environments.即用来创建和配置轻量级、可重现的、便携式的开发环境。使用Vagrant可以将创建虚拟机的整个过程自动化起来 阅读全文
-
常用Git代码托管服务分享
摘要:常用Git代码托管服务分享2013-10-03 02:15 by jv9,734阅读,9评论,收藏,编辑Git Repository代码托管服务越来越流行,目前有很多商业公司和个人团队逐渐切换项目到 Git平台进行代码托管。本文分享一些常用的Git代码托管服务,其中一些提供私有项目保护服务,特别有利于远程团队协作开发项目使用。GitHubhttps://github.com/目前最流行的Git服务,也是人气最旺盛的Git代码托管网站。但是私有项目需要付费,个人认为GitHub更适合开源项目使用,很多开发人员在这个平台上分享开发经验,同时协作完成项目。GitLabhttp://www.gitla 阅读全文
-
Git学习笔记与IntelliJ IDEA整合
摘要:Git学习笔记与IntelliJ IDEA整合Git学习笔记与IntelliJ IDEA整合一.Git学习笔记(基于Github) 1.安装和配置Git 下载地址:http://git-scm.com/downloads Git简要使用说明:http://rogerdudler.github.io/git-guide/index.zh.html Github官方使用说明:https://help.github.com/articles/set-up-git 默认安装 配置 1)首先你要告诉git你的名字 git config --global user.name "Your Na.. 阅读全文
-
ubuntu 下面手动安装jdk
摘要:ubuntu 下面手动安装jdk刚才在ubuntu安装jdk和eclipse,感觉主要安装jdk比较麻烦,记录一下笔记以备后面查看先在官网上下载jdk的tar包:http://www.oracle.com/technetwork/java/javase/downloads/jdk7-downloads-1880260.html一般用浏览器下载一般下载在/home/username/下载这个目录里面进入这个目录,解压并且把解压后的文件夹放在/opt/java中1sudo tar -zxvf jdk-7u40-linux-i586.tar.gz -C /opt/java 接着,要修改/etc/en 阅读全文
-
SolrCloud攻略
摘要:SolrCloud攻略近期一直在使用SolrCloud,乘着酒醉大概总结一下。1.安装原来一直有个误区,认为SolrCloud启动时,必须至少有个core才可以,其实不然。首先按照Solr官方wiki上正常部署Solr,然后在Tomcat的启动参数中加入以下参数:如果使用内置的zookeeper:-DzkRun-DzkHost=localhost:9080。对于DzHost,可以是多个地址,用逗号分割,端口是Tomcat的端口+1000。一般Tomcat的端口是8080,所以这里是9080。如果使用外部的zookeeper:-DzkHost={ip:port}对于这两种情况,使用多个zooke 阅读全文
-
cocos2d-x 从win32到android移植的全套解决方案
摘要:cocos2d-x 从win32到android移植的全套解决方案引言:我们使用cocos2d-x引擎制作了一款飞行射击游戏,其中创新性地融入了手势识别功能。但是我们在移植过程中遇到了很多的问题,同时也发现网上的资料少而不全。所以在项目行将结束的时候,我们特地写了这篇文章来完整记录我们整个移植的过程,纪念我们项目的成功完成,更以此来表达对帮助过我们的人的感谢。移植过程中我们在网上得到了很多帮助,更要感谢黄杨学长在最后时刻帮助我们突破难关!0、开发平台系统:win8 profession 64bitIDE:vs2012 rtm, eclipsecocos2d-x版本:2.1.21、移植准备在wi 阅读全文
-
博客迁移到亚马逊云端1
摘要:将我的博客迁移到亚马逊云端(1)Octopress已经被公认为Geeker的博客框架。它所拥有的特性都很符合Geeker的癖好:强大的命令行操作方式、简洁的MarkDown语法、灵活的插件配置、美轮美奂的theme(自带响应式设计哦)、完全可定义的部署……一般大家都喜欢把博客部署到github pages上,免费速度快,与Octopress无缝结合。但是自己最近迷上了AWS,就捉摸着将自己的Octopress博客部署到AWS的S3上,使用CloudFront做CDN,使用Amazon Route 53做域名映射。倒腾了两天,终于搞定了,也学到了很多东西。不敢私藏,拿出来和大家分享。这篇文章主要 阅读全文
-
Microsoft Message Analyzer (微软消息分析器,“网络抓包工具 - Network Monitor”的替代品)官方正式版现已发布
摘要:Microsoft Message Analyzer (微软消息分析器,“网络抓包工具 - Network Monitor”的替代品)官方正式版现已发布来自官方日志的喜悦被誉为全新开始的消息分析器时代,由MMA为您开启,博客原文写的很激动,大家可以点击这里浏览:http://blogs.technet.com/b/messageanalyzer/archive/2013/09/25/message-analyzer-has-released-a-new-beginning.aspx简单的说一下MMA的发展历程:经过了之前的Windows server 2003中的Network Monitor 阅读全文
-
Navicat Premium 11.0.10破解补丁
摘要:Navicat Premium 11.0.10破解补丁Navicat Premium 是一个可多重连接的数据库管理工具,让你以单一程序同時连接到 MySQL、SQL Server、SQLite、Oracle 和 PostgreSQL 数据库,令管理不同类型的数据库更加方便。原版下载地址:http://www.navicat.com/download/navicat-premium 32位补丁下载地址:http://pan.baidu.com/share/link?shareid=1872061245&uk=2182455221使用方法:将压缩包内的navicat.exe覆盖到原来的安装 阅读全文